Replacement Cost - The typical cost for electrical panel replacement ranges from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on the panel size and complexity. Larger or more advanced panels may cost more, with some projects reaching up to $4,500. Variations in pricing are common based on local labor rates and materials.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for replacing an electrical panel usually fall between $500 and $1,500. The duration of the work and accessibility of the installation site influence the overall labor costs. Some service providers may include additional fees for permits or inspections.
Material Expenses - The cost of new electrical panels typically ranges from $300 to $1,200. Premium or high-capacity panels tend to be more expensive, with options for added features increasing the overall price. Material costs can fluctuate based on manufacturer and specifications.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include permits, inspection fees, or upgrades to existing wiring, which can add $200 to $800. These costs vary based on local regulations and the scope of the replacement project.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When should I consider replacing my electrical panel? An electrical panel replacement may be needed if the panel is outdated, shows signs of damage, or cannot support new electrical demands in the home.
How can I tell if my electrical panel needs to be upgraded? Signs include frequent circuit breaker trips, burning smells, rust or corrosion, and frequent electrical issues in the household.
What are the benefits of replacing an electrical panel? Upgrading can improve electrical safety, increase capacity for new appliances, and reduce the risk of electrical failures or fire hazards.
How long does an electrical panel replacement typically take? The process generally takes a few hours, but duration can vary based on the home's electrical complexity and the specific panel being installed.
